调整接近传感器感知阈值的方法和系统技术方案

技术编号:13976707 阅读:51 留言:0更新日期:2016-11-11 16:22
本发明专利技术涉及一种调整接近传感器感知阈值的方法和系统,该方法包括如下步骤:获取接近传感器测量得到的反射红外线强度值;通过所述反射红外线强度值和所述接近传感器的感知阈值判断所述接近传感器的状态;若判定所述接近传感器处于远离状态,则计算所述反射红外线强度值的变化值;当所述变化值大于设定值时,执行调整接近传感器感知阈值的算法,根据所述反射红外线强度值对所述接近传感器的感知阈值进行调整。本发明专利技术既能通过调整感知阈值来提高接近传感器的灵敏度,又不会频繁地往感知阈值寄存器里写数据,从而降低系统负担,减小芯片损耗。

【技术实现步骤摘要】

本专利技术涉及电子
,特别是涉及一种调整接近传感器感知阈值的方法和系统
技术介绍
触摸式的手机凭借其日益强大的功能,在日常生活中得到了广泛的应用。当用户通话时,脸部贴近手机的触摸屏会因误触发而导致挂断电话,因此通常会在手机上安装接近传感器,通过接近传感器可以判断用户脸部是否靠近手机,并在脸部靠近手机时关闭手机的触摸屏以防止误触发。目前,接近传感器已经大量地应用在手机的各种应用程序中,比如通话、自动背光、触摸屏黑屏手势、指纹控制等等。接近传感器可以测量反射红外线强度值,一般都会为接近传感器设置感知阈值,通过感知阈值以及接近传感器测量得到的反射红外线强度值来判断接近传感器发出的红外线是否被遮挡,从而判断物体是否接近或远离接近传感器。但是接近传感器容易受到环境因素、用户运动状态以及手机本身性能退化的影响,造成灵敏度下降,因此为了提高接近传感器的灵敏度,目前的手机会在接近传感器开启后,通过特定的算法对接近传感器的感知阈值进行动态调整,以消除环境因素或手机本身性能退化对接近传感器灵敏度的影响。但是快速地往手机芯片中的感知阈值寄存器里面写数据,不仅仅会增加系统的负担,而且会增加手机芯片的损耗,长此以往,将会严重影响手机的性能。
技术实现思路
基于此,为解决现有技术中的问题,本专利技术提供一种调整接近传感器感知阈值的方法和系统,既能提高接近传感器的灵敏度,又不会增加系统负担及芯片损耗。为实现上述目的,本专利技术实施例采用以下技术方案:一种调整接近传感器感知阈值的方法,包括如下步骤:获取接近传感器测量得到的反射红外线强度值;通过所述反射红外线强度值和所述接近传感器的感知阈值判断所述接近传感器的状态;若判定所述接近传感器处于远离状态,则计算所述反射红外线强度值的变化值;当所述变化值大于设定值时,执行调整接近传感器感知阈值的算法,根据所述反射红外线强度值对所述接近传感器的感知阈值进行调整。本专利技术还提供一种调整接近传感器感知阈值的系统,包括:获取模块,用于获取接近传感器测量得到的反射红外线强度值;第一判断模块,用于通过所述反射红外线强度值和所述接近传感器的感知阈值判断所述接近传感器的状态;计算模块,用于在判定所述接近传感器处于远离状态时,计算所述反射红外线强度值的变化值;第二判断模块,用于判断所述变化值是否大于设定值;调整模块,用于在所述变化值大于所述设定值时,执行调整接近传感器感知阈值的算法,根据所述反射红外线强度值对所述接近传感器的感知阈值进行调整。基于本专利技术的上述技术方案,在接近传感器被使能后,仅在获取的反射红外线强度值的变化值小于设定值时,才启动执行调整接近传感器感知阈值的算法,对接近传感器的感知阈值进行调整,这样既可提高接近传感器的灵敏度,又可以有效避免频繁地往感知阈值寄存器里写入数据,从而降低系统的负担,也降低了芯片的损耗。附图说明图1是本专利技术的调整接近传感器感知阈值的方法在一个实施例中的流程示意图;图2是本专利技术的调整接近传感器感知阈值的系统在一个实施例中的结构示 意图。具体实施方式下面将结合较佳实施例及附图对本专利技术的内容作进一步详细描述。显然,下文所描述的实施例仅用于解释本专利技术,而非对本专利技术的限定。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。应当理解的是,尽管在下文中采用术语“第一”、“第二”等来描述各种信息,但这些信息不应限于这些术语,这些术语仅用来将同一类型的信息彼此区分开。例如,在不脱离本专利技术范围的情况下,“第一”信息也可以被称为“第二”信息,类似的,“第二”信息也可以被称为“第一”信息。另外还需要说明的是,为了便于描述,附图中仅示出了与本专利技术相关的部分而非全部内容。图1是本专利技术的调整接近传感器感知阈值的方法在一个实施例中的流程示意图,本实施例中的调整接近传感器感知阈值的方法可由配置有接近传感器的终端设备(例如手机、平板等终端设备)的控制系统来执行,为便于描述,下面仅以配置有接近传感器的手机为例,来说明本实施例中的调整接近传感器感知阈值的方法,但不能以此来限制本专利技术的保护范围,本专利技术的保护范围应当以权利要求书限定的保护范围为准。如图1所示,本实施例中的调整接近传感器感知阈值的方法包括以下步骤:步骤S100,获取接近传感器测量得到的反射红外线强度值;手机的接近传感器工作后,可以测量反射红外线强度值。在本实施例中,手机的控制系统可获取接近传感器测量得到的反射红外线强度值。在本实施例中,若手机的应用程序(例如通话应用程序)需要启动接近传感器时,手机的控制系统可通过使能信号使接近传感器开启并进入工作状态,然后手机的控制系统获取接近传感器测量得到的反射红外线强度值。步骤S200,通过所述反射红外线强度值和所述接近传感器的感知阈值判断所述接近传感器的状态;若判定所述接近传感器处于远离状态,则进入步骤S300;接近传感器有两种状态,分别是远离状态和接近状态,通过接近传感器测 量得到的反射红外线强度值以及接近传感器的感知阈值便可以判断接近传感器的状态。在一种可选的实施方式中,接近传感器的感知阈值可设置为单一阈值H,若获取的反射红外线强度值大于此单一阈值H,说明接近传感器与外界物体接近,发射的红外线被外界物体所遮挡,故判定接近传感器处于接近状态,即接近传感器发生接近事件;若获取的反射红外线强度值小于此单一阈值H,说明接近传感器与外界物体远离,发射的红外线未被外界物体所遮挡或者遮挡不足,故判定接近传感器处于远离状态,即接近传感器发生远离事件;若获取的反射红外线强度值等于此单一阈值H,既可以判定接近传感器处于远离状态,又可以判定接近传感器处于接近状态,具体依据实际需求进行设置。当接近传感器的感知阈值为单一阈值H时,若获取的反射红外线强度值在单一阈值H附近波动,将会使得极短时间内接近传感器的状态在远离和接近之间来回变化,即产生抖动,这对于利用接近传感器的状态进行控制的应用程序将会产生大大不利,因此,为了防止上述抖动,在另一种可选的实施方式中,接近传感器的感知阈值包括接近阈值N和远离阈值M,接近阈值N为判定接近传感器处于接近状态的下限值,远离阈值M为判定接近传感器处于远离状态的上限值,其中接近阈值N大于远离阈值M。当获取的反射红外线强度值大于接近阈值N时,判定接近传感器处于接近状态;当获取的反射红外线强度值小于远离阈值M时,判定接近传感器处于远离状态。此处给出一个具体实例,假设远离阈值M为100,接近阈值N为200,假设t时刻获取的反射红外线强度值为d1为50,d1<M,故接近传感器处于远离状态。假设t+Δt时刻获取的反射红外线强度值d2为150,由于d2仍然不大于接近阈值N,所以此时仍然判定接近传感器处于远离状态。若t+2Δt时刻获取的反射红外线强度值d3为220,由于d3>N,故判定接近传感器处于为接近状态。再若t+3Δt时刻获取的反射红外线强度值d4为140,由于d4仍不小于远离阈值M,故仍将判定接近传感器处于接近状态。因此,通过设置接近阈值N和远离阈值M,可以有效防止接近传感器的状态在远离和接近之间抖动。步骤S300,计算所述反射红外线强度值的变化值;在手机的控制系统判定接近传感器处于远离状态时,计算反射红外线强度值的变化值。该变化本文档来自技高网...

【技术保护点】
一种调整接近传感器感知阈值的方法,其特征在于,包括如下步骤:获取接近传感器测量得到的反射红外线强度值;通过所述反射红外线强度值和所述接近传感器的感知阈值判断所述接近传感器的状态;若判定所述接近传感器处于远离状态,则计算所述反射红外线强度值的变化值;当所述变化值大于设定值时,执行调整接近传感器感知阈值的算法,根据所述反射红外线强度值对所述接近传感器的感知阈值进行调整。

【技术特征摘要】
1.一种调整接近传感器感知阈值的方法,其特征在于,包括如下步骤:获取接近传感器测量得到的反射红外线强度值;通过所述反射红外线强度值和所述接近传感器的感知阈值判断所述接近传感器的状态;若判定所述接近传感器处于远离状态,则计算所述反射红外线强度值的变化值;当所述变化值大于设定值时,执行调整接近传感器感知阈值的算法,根据所述反射红外线强度值对所述接近传感器的感知阈值进行调整。2.根据权利要求1所述的调整接近传感器感知阈值的方法,其特征在于,还包括:当所述变化值小于或等于所述设定值时,以第一轮询速率继续获取所述反射红外线强度值;在根据所述反射红外线强度值对所述接近传感器的感知阈值进行调整之后,以第二轮询速率继续获取所述反射红外线强度值。3.根据权利要求2所述的调整接近传感器感知阈值的方法,其特征在于,在根据所述反射红外线强度值对所述接近传感器的感知阈值进行调整之后,还包括如下步骤:若判定所述接近传感器处于接近状态,则停止执行所述调整接近传感器感知阈值的算法,并以第三轮询速率继续获取所述反射红外线强度值。4.根据权利要求3所述的调整接近传感器感知阈值的方法,其特征在于,所述第三轮询速率和所述第二轮询速率均大于所述第一轮询速率。5.根据权利要求3所述的调整接近传感器感知阈值的方法,其特征在于,所述感知阈值包括接近阈值和远离阈值,所述接近阈值大于所述远离阈值;通过所述反射红外线强度值和所述接近传感器的感知阈值判断所述接近传感器的状态的过程包括:当所述反射红外线强度值大于所述接近阈值时,判定所述接近传感器处于接近状态;当所述反射红外线强度值小于所述远离阈值时,判定所述接近传感器处于远离状态。6.根据权利要求5所述的调整接...

【专利技术属性】
技术研发人员:张强
申请(专利权)人:广东欧珀移动通信有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1